Abstract: |
The data are project results for current and future wildfire and post-fire debris flow threat to electrical infrastructure in California. The project assessed conditions using current and future fire data from Cal-Adapt, and current and future wildfire and post-fire debris flow threat from Li and Chester (doi: 10.1088/2634-4505/acb3f5), which are publicly available. Transmission line, substation, and power generation threats were assed. The work was completed in 2024 and published as a journal article in 2025. |
